Consumer prices - March 2023

In March 2023 the rate of change of the Italian consumer price index for the whole nation (NIC) was -0.4% on monthly basis and +7.6% on annual basis (from +9.1% in February); the flash estimate was +7.7%.

The slowdown in inflation was mainly due to the deceleration of the prices of non-regulated energy goods (from +40.8% to +18.9%) and to the accentuated decline in those of regulated energy (from -16.4% to -20.3%). On the contrary, an upward contribution to the inflation rate came from the prices of unprocessed food (from +8.7% to +9.1%), services relating to housing (from +3.3% to +3.5%), tobacco (from +1.8% to +2.5%) and those of services related to recreation including repair and personal care (from +6.1% to +6.3%).

The core inflation (all-items excluding energy and unprocessed food) was +6.3% and the annual rate of change of the all-items index excluding energy was +6.4%, both stable compared to the previous month.

The annual rate of change of prices of goods was +9.7% (from +12.4% in February) and that of prices of services was +4.5% (from +4.4% in the previous month). As a consequence, the negative inflationary gap between services and goods decreases (from -8.0 percentage points in February to -5.2).

Prices of grocery and unprocessed food increased by +0.7% on monthly basis and by +12.6% on annual basis (down from +12.7% in the previous month).

The month on month decrease of NIC was due to the prices of Non-regulated energy products (-9.6%) and of regulated energy products (-4.6%); at the opposite an upward effect comes from the prices of unprocesses food (+1.0%), services related to transport (+0.9%), processed food including alcohol and tobacco (+0.7% both), semi-durable goods (+0.5%), non-durable goods and services related to recreation, including repair and personal care and services related to housing (all three +0.3%).

In March 2023, the Italian harmonised index of consumer prices (HICP) increased by 0.8% on monthly basis, mainly due to the end of the winter sales of clothing and footwear (not considered by NIC); as a result, the annual rate of change of the Italian HICP was 8.1% (from +9.8% in February); the flash estimate was +8.2%.

In the first quarter of 2023, inflation measured by HICP had a wider impact on the sub-population with the lowest level of equivalent expenditure than on households with highest amount of expenditure (+12.5 and +8.2% respectively).
